Defining Safety in Puerto Rico
Safety assessments combine official crime reports, police presence, and neighborhood cohesion. Puerto Rico’s National Police and FBI statistics, published annually, provide the baseline for this analysis.
In addition to raw numbers, local government programs—such as neighborhood watch councils and youth outreach—play a critical role in maintaining low incident rates.

THE TOPIC IN FOUR PARTS
Four Dimensions of Safety Assessment
Evaluating a town’s security involves multiple layers:
- 1. Crime StatisticsReview annual reports from the Puerto Rico Police Department and FBI to compare homicide, robbery, and burglary rates.
- 2. Police PresenceAssess the number of local officers per capita and the frequency of community patrols.
- 3. Neighborhood CohesionLook for active neighborhood watch groups, community events, and local volunteer initiatives.
- 4. Infrastructure QualityCheck for street lighting, emergency call boxes, and proximity to hospitals or police stations.

Which Puerto Rican town has the lowest violent crime rate?+
According to the most recent FBI data, towns such as Yauco and San Sebastián consistently report the lowest violent crime per capita.
How does community engagement affect safety?+
Active neighborhood watch programs and local policing partnerships often correlate with reduced crime, as residents report higher vigilance and quicker incident reporting.
Are there safety concerns for tourists in these towns?+
Tourists generally find these towns safe, though standard precautions—avoiding isolated areas at night and securing personal belongings—remain advisable.
